On the Roof!
Daily Shoot - What fuels your creative process? Illustrate it in a photo today.
The tranquility of our little cul-de-sac was shattered by the wail of sirens this morning as fire trucks raced to our neighbours' house. This is a shot of firefighters cutting a hole through the snow-covered roof. Thankfully the neighbours weren't home and no one was injured. See today's 365 pic for another view of the scene.
This shot does typify how my creative process works for photography. I can usually see some beauty or something compelling when I look at a scene, but the moment I look through the viewfinder I really start to distill things and look for the essence. It feels like the narrowed field of vision through the viewfinder clears the clutter from both the periphery of the scene and my brain :-). I love the way the firefighters suddenly appeared here - through the smoke, vapour, trees and snow drifts on the roof.
